Google Glass: Do You Want to See Social Media

I guess attractive people can't make everything look good...

As if we didn't already have enough access to social media, google plans to release a set of glasses which appear to alert you to notifications, messages...you know the rundown. They tell you what's happening with your social media life and allow you to send messages or make changes with your voice...Other than looking stupid, my question to people is WHY!?!? I totally understand why Google is going after this...people will snap them up at least for the initial push of interest. People are crazy about social media...but really people...WHY?

Why do you need to know IMMEDIATELY that you got a notification? Why do you need to be constantly connected to others visually when you just have to reach in your pocket and grab your phone? Why can't we remove ourselves from the internet for more than five seconds?

I realize the irony of complaining about excessive social media usage while writing a blog which I post to around 10-20 times per day, but I promise, I, very easily, don't use the internet at all after work or on weekends. I don't expect others too do that...but I just dread the day when I'm having a conversation with  someone when I notice them scrolling through notifications, checking a text, or sending an email in their glasses...I may be turning into an adult, but we should all take a time-out from social media, at least for a little bit every day.
